What Is an Air Tire Gauge and Why Is It Important for Vehicle Maintenance?
An air tire gauge is a tool that measures the air pressure within a vehicle’s tires. Proper tire pressure is crucial for safety, fuel efficiency, and tire lifespan.
The American Automobile Association (AAA) defines it as a precise instrument designed to ensure tires are inflated to manufacturer-recommended specifications. Accurate tire pressure contributes to optimal vehicle performance and safety.
The air tire gauge can come in various forms, including digital, dial, and pencil gauges. Each type provides a reading in pounds per square inch (PSI), which is the standard unit for measuring tire pressure. Maintaining the correct pressure helps in enhancing traction, improving handling, and preventing blowouts.
According to the National Highway Traffic Safety Administration (NHTSA), under-inflated tires can compromise vehicle safety and efficiency. This highlights the importance of regular checking and maintenance.
Tire pressure can be affected by temperature changes, tire wear, and driving conditions. For example, a drop in temperature can lead to reduced tire pressure, making regular checks essential during seasonal changes.
The NHTSA reports that approximately 3,000 fatalities occur annually in the U.S. due to tire-related crashes, emphasizing the necessity of maintaining proper tire pressure.
Poor tire maintenance results in increased fuel consumption, higher emissions, and elevated costs for vehicle owners. Under-inflated tires can decrease mileage by up to 3% per PSI loss, impacting both the economy and the environment.
To mitigate these issues, organizations like AAA recommend regular tire inspections and proper inflation practices. They advocate using a quality air tire gauge to routinely check pressure, ensuring safety and efficiency.
Implementing air pressure monitoring systems in vehicles can also aid in maintaining optimal tire health. Educating drivers on the importance of tire maintenance further supports sustainable vehicle operation.

How Does Proper Tire Pressure Impact Fuel Efficiency and Safety?
Proper tire pressure significantly impacts fuel efficiency and safety. Correct pressure helps maintain optimal contact between the tires and the road. When tires are properly inflated, rolling resistance decreases. Lower rolling resistance allows the vehicle to require less energy to move, which improves fuel efficiency.
Under-inflated tires create higher rolling resistance. This condition leads to increased fuel consumption as the engine must work harder. Additionally, low tire pressure can cause uneven tire wear. This uneven wear can shorten the lifespan of the tires and lead to a higher chance of blowouts, compromising safety.
Over-inflated tires also pose risks. They can lead to reduced traction, especially on wet roads. This reduction in traction increases the likelihood of losing control of the vehicle, which poses a safety hazard.
Maintaining the recommended tire pressure improves vehicle handling. It enhances steering response and increases stability during turns. Improved handling increases driver confidence and safety.
Regularly checking tire pressure is essential. Drivers should use a reliable tire pressure gauge. They should refer to the vehicle’s owner manual or the sticker found on the driver’s side door for the recommended pressure. Proper maintenance ensures both efficient fuel consumption and safe driving conditions.

How Do You Choose the Right Tire Pressure Gauge for Your Needs?
To choose the right tire pressure gauge for your needs, consider accuracy, type, design, and features. Each of these factors influences the reliability and usability of the gauge.
Accuracy: A good tire pressure gauge should provide precise measurements. Many gauges are manufactured to have an accuracy of ±1 psi, which is sufficient for most vehicles. A study by Consumer Reports (2020) noted that gauges with a higher accuracy range lead to better tire maintenance and improved fuel efficiency.
Type: There are various types of tire pressure gauges available, including analog, digital, and pencil gauges.
– Analog gauges have a dial that indicates pressure. They are simple to use but may be harder to read in low light.
– Digital gauges provide readings in an easy-to-read format and often include additional features like auto-off functions.
– Pencil gauges are compact and budget-friendly but may not be as accurate as digital or analog models.
Design: Look for a gauge that is easy to grip and operate. A comfortable design helps users apply the proper pressure without straining. Ergonomic designs are preferred, especially for users with limited hand strength or dexterity.
Features: Some gauges come with additional features that enhance convenience. For example, features like a built-in light allow for measurements in low-light conditions. Certain models also include multiple unit settings (psi, kPa, bar), which can be useful depending on the audience’s preferences or needs.
Price: The cost of tire pressure gauges can vary significantly. Basic models are often available for around $5 to $15, while high-end digital gauges can range from $20 to $50 or more. The investment should align with your specific needs and frequency of use.
Regular calibration: Over time, gauges can lose accuracy. It is recommended to check your gauge’s accuracy annually to ensure it provides reliable readings.
